Question
which point on the y - axis lies on the line that passes through point c and is perpendicular to line ab? (-6,0) (0,-6) (0,2) (2,0)
Step1: Find slope of line AB
Let's assume two - point form. If we have two points on line AB, say \(A(x_1,y_1)\) and \(B(x_2,y_2)\). From the graph, assume \(A(- 4,4)\) and \(B(2,-8)\). The slope \(m_{AB}=\frac{y_2 - y_1}{x_2 - x_1}=\frac{-8 - 4}{2+4}=\frac{-12}{6}=-2\).
Step2: Find slope of perpendicular line
The slope of a line perpendicular to a line with slope \(m\) is \(m'=-\frac{1}{m}\). So, if \(m_{AB}=-2\), the slope of the line perpendicular to AB, \(m = \frac{1}{2}\).
Step3: Find the equation of the line passing through point C
Assume point \(C(4,4)\). Using the point - slope form \(y - y_1=m(x - x_1)\), where \(x_1 = 4,y_1 = 4\) and \(m=\frac{1}{2}\). We get \(y - 4=\frac{1}{2}(x - 4)\), which simplifies to \(y-4=\frac{1}{2}x - 2\), or \(y=\frac{1}{2}x+2\).
Step4: Find the y - intercept
The line intersects the y - axis when \(x = 0\). Substitute \(x = 0\) into \(y=\frac{1}{2}x + 2\), we get \(y=2\). So the point on the y - axis is \((0,2)\).
